Default Situation I struggle with

villain is 55/3/0.66

Should I bother betting the flop?
I have no hand and no odds to draw.
The guy has a high VPIP, but he coldcalled so unless he holds sooted K rags, he has a better hand.
He'll never fold a PP, A-high, with a better K-high he will peel, and I'm OOP.

I consider this a must bet. You are ahead about half the time and can take down the pot with little investment. Some guys with those kinds of stats cold call with 93s.
